Underimpressed

I recently rented a 2019 Infiniti QX60 while my primary vehicle was being repaired. While some of my discomfort can be attributed to going from a sedan to a largish SUV, I immediately noticed a significant degree of creaks and rattles in the Infiniti, particularly from the cheap plastic openers for the center console. The climate controls were counterintuitive, and the eco driving mode was a joke. I had to exert maximum foot pressure to merge into traffic. The seats were comfortable enough but again, the side view mirrors were cut at odd angles and felt like I couldn't see everything. And the crash-mitigation system kept flashing at me, even when there were no cars or other obstructions in sight. Again, I'm no SUV driver, but I figured at this price Infiniti ought to offer a more-luxurious product.

Luxury minus the pep

I’ve always loved Nissan. On my 3rd Maxima, so I thought I’d upgrade to the Infinity. The care is beautiful, comes fully loaded, high safety reviews... A lot of bang for the buck for sure! However I feel for as large and heavy this SUV is Infinity slacked with the engine. It needs more torque. The 3.0 isn’t enough for this beast. Knowing Infinity uses larger engines in some of their sedans I feel they cut corner with the SUV. Seriously thinking of supercharging this once the warranty is over.

After a lot of research, best luxury value.

Comfortable first class interior, quiet smooth ride with small well thought out features eg. auto Dim and bright light adjustments, rain sensor wipers are delightful. Very comfortable seats with memory adjustments. Pulls 16ft boat effortlessly. FWD that with as needed AWD as needed makes it good stable winter vehicle....as compared RWD to AWD.
